Wanderers fly through to Grand Final

Thumbnail

The Western Sydney Wanderers U20 Academy team have progressed to the Grand Final for the second consecutive season after a convincing 5-0 win over North Shore Mariners.

Kosta Grozos was the undoubted star of the show, scoring a hat trick and grabbing an assist, while Samuel Silvera and Jarrod Carluccio also found the back of the net. 

After a bright start, the early pressure paid off for the Wanderers when Silvera was upended just inside the penalty area. Grozos stepped up and sent the goalkeeper the wrong way from the spot to put the Red & Black 1-0 up.

The Wanderers didn’t have to wait long for their second goal with Silvera playing a neat one-two with Grozos on the edge of the penalty area before firing home from an acute angle. 

Kosta Grozos was seemingly involved in everything the Wanderers did and got into a good position after a mazy dribble past three North Shore defenders. 

North Shore responded and Wanderers goalkeeper Daniel Axford had to be on his toes to make two sharp saves in the space of a minute.

Puflet and Abdelranham Kuku combined to set up Grozos but a North Shore defender was able to block his shot. 

However, Grozos was not to be denied and reacted quickest to a loose ball on the edge of the penalty area, blasting it into the top corner to get his second of the contest.

After the break, Grozos continued his excelled performance setting up Malcolm Ward after a good run, only for the right back’s shot to go wide. 

Grozos and Puflett would then have further efforts on goal before Grozos completed his hat trick slamming the ball from 20-yards out to make it 4-0. 

Substitute Carluccio was lively in the final stages and had a few chances after getting behind the North Shore backline. 

Carluccio showed dogged determination and would get his reward with five minutes left after smashing the ball past the keeper after a neat turn inside the penalty area. 

There was even time for Carluccio to set up Richard Steward but the left back was unable to trouble the keeper.

Next weekend, the U20 side will play Northern Tigers after they defeated Hills Brumbies 3-1 in their semi-final.

The U18 team has also progressed to the Grand Final, coincidentally by defeating Northern Tigers at Sydney United Sports Centre. 

After a scoreless first half, the Red & Black won 4-0 thanks to a double from Anthony Vastag, as well as goals from Yousef Sawalha and Alexander Lopez. 

The U18s will play Central Coast Mariners in next weekend’s decider. 

Western Sydney Wanderers 5 (Kosta Grozos 9’ 42’ 68’ Samuel Silvera 15’ Jarrod Carluccio 85’)
North Shore Mariners 0

Western Sydney Wanderers: Daniel Axford, Malcolm Ward, Lachlan Campbell, Richard Stewart, Daniel Wilmering, Abdelrahman Kuku, Joshua Bartolotto (Zachary Duncan 66’), Kosta Grozos (Mohamed Al Taay 69’), Oliver Puflett, Samuel Silvera (Brandon Stojcevski 46’), Mohamed Najjar (Jarrod Carluccio 60’)
Unused substitutes: Jack Groeneveld
